Soldiers of Fortune (1919)

Strangers in a strange land, face to face with death in a hundred forms, they never waver.

Soldiers of Fortune (1919) poster

Civil engineer Robert Clay is commissioned by wealthy New Yorker Mr. Langham to open iron deposits in the tiny South American republic of Olancho. General Mendoza, the unscrupulous head of the army, unsuccessfully tries to persuade President Alvarez, and then Clay, to divide the spoils of the contract.

Director: Allan Dwan
Genre: Adventure, Drama
Runtime: 70 min
